  1. Tristaum is the name of my townland. There are five families in it Kelly's, Clarke's, Larkin's, Barry's and Scotts. There are twenty nine people in it. There are five slated houses in my townland and each of them is about twenty five years built. Four of them are about three hundred yards from the high road and the other is built on the side of it. They are all two storey houses except one which is a one storey house. There are no old ruins in my townland beacuse there were never anymore people in it.
